#6569f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6569f2 is composed of 39.6% red, 41.2%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.3% cyan, 56.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 238.3 degrees, a saturation of 84.4% and a lightness of 67.3%. #6569f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#cad2ff with #0000e5.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#6569f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6569f2 has RGB values of R:101, G:105,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 6646258.
